Overview and Definition
Crossy Road is an endless runner game developed by the Australian indie studio Hipster Whale in 2014. The game was initially released on iOS devices but soon spread across various platforms, including Android, Windows Phone, macOS, and later even console versions for Nintendo Switch and PlayStation Vita. Crossy Road can be played both online and offline, catering to a diverse audience.
